Ethanol is a renewable fuel made from various biomass sources like corn, sugarcane, and grasses. It's commonly used as a fuel additive to increase octane and reduce emissions in gasoline. It can also be used as a primary fuel source, particularly in flex-fuel vehicles. Beyond fuel, ethanol is used as a solvent, disinfectant, and in the production of various chemicals.
